机床编程入门基础知识教程
机床编程是现代制造业不可或缺的一项技能,它是控制机床完成加工任务的关键环节。本文将介绍机床编程的基础知识,包括编程语言、代码结构、常用命令以及常见错误等内容,旨在帮助初学者快速入门。
一、编程语言
机床编程常用的编程语言包括G代码和M代码。G代码是控制机床运动的指令,如加工路径、坐标系和刀具半径等。M代码是控制机床辅助功能的指令,如冷却液、进给和主轴等。在编程时,需要根据具体的加工要求选择合适的G代码和M代码进行编写。
二、代码结构
机床编程的代码结构主要由块(Block)和行(Line)组成。一个块是一组有关同一个工作的指令,它由一个小数点、一个块号和指令组成。行是由一个或多个块组成的,每个块占一行。代码结构通常如下所示:
N100 G01 X100 Y100 F100 ;第1行
N200 G02 X200 Y200 I50 J50 ;第2行
N300 M03 ;第3行
其中,N100、N200和N300是块号,G01、G02和M03是指令。
三、常用命令
1. G代码:
- G00:快速定位。机床以快速速度无切削等效地移动到下一个位置。
- G01:线性插补。机床以匀速直线移动到下一个位置。
- G02:顺时针圆弧插补。机床以顺时针方向沿圆弧路径移动到下一个位置。
- G03:逆时针圆弧插补。机床以逆时针方向沿圆弧路径移动到下一个位置。
2. M代码:
- M03:主轴正转。打开主轴,并设定正转方向。
- M04:主轴反转。打开主轴,并设定反转方向。
- M05:主轴停止。关闭主轴。
四、常见错误
1. 坐标错误:机床编程中,经常需要指定工件坐标系和机床坐标系。如果设置不正确或转换错误,会导致加工精度下降或加工失败。
2. 半径错误:在圆弧插补中,如果半径设定错误,会导致加工形状不符合要求或无法完成加工任务。
3. 速度错误:在定义进给速度和主轴转速时,如果速度设定不正确,会导致加工效率低下或加工质量下降。
总结:
机床编程是一项非常重要的技能,掌握了机床编程基础知识,可以有效提高生产效率和产品质量。本文介绍了机床编程的基础知识,包括编程语言、代码结构、常用命令以及常见错误等内容。希望读者能通过本文快速了解机床编程的基本概念,为深入学习和实践打下坚实基础。
如果你喜欢我们的文章,欢迎您分享或收藏为众码农的文章! 我们网站的目标是帮助每一个对编程和网站建设以及各类acg,galgame,SLG游戏感兴趣的人,无论他们的水平和经验如何。我们相信,只要有热情和毅力,任何人都可以成为一个优秀的程序员。欢迎你加入我们,开始你的美妙旅程!www.weizhongchou.cn
发表评论 取消回复